Thermal Acquisition and Voting Architecture

Engineered to provide six channels of temperature monitoring, the Bently Nevada 3500/60 133835-01 accepts both Resistance Temperature Detector (RTD) and Thermocouple (TC) temperature inputs. The internal circuitry conditions these thermal signals and compares them against user-programmable alarm setpoints configured via the 3500 Rack Configuration Software. Depending on the installed I/O module variant, the system supports non-isolated configurations for mixed RTD and TC inputs, or isolated options providing 250 Vdc of channel-to-channel isolation against external electrical interference. Furthermore, when deployed in a Triple Modular Redundant (TMR) architecture, the temperature monitors must be installed adjacent to each other in groups of three, utilizing specialized voting mechanisms to prevent single-point failures and ensure accurate protection.

Field Installation Guidelines

Mounting and Grounding: Install the module exclusively within designated slots of a standard 3500 rack enclosure. Ensure the rear I/O module is firmly secured and torqued to prevent backplane bus misalignment. Connect the earth ground stud directly to the plant grounding grid using low-impedance copper braided wire to mitigate high-frequency noise interference.

Signal Wiring: Route all RTD and thermocouple signal cables separately from high-voltage power conduits and variable frequency drive outputs. Utilize shielded twisted-pair cabling, terminating the shield strictly at the system rack grounding bar to maintain electromagnetic compatibility.
